Good Morning All,

I've spent a lot of time trying to design the right sound System in the Cab of Syborg
and the good news is the Guy's at Kicker have stepped up and helped design a very simple yet effective system.

2008_07_06_kicker_001.jpg


Dan over in Kicker R & D selected all of the Compinents for the truck and I can't thank him enough.
I've learned that more isn't always better.


This amp that was choosen is the ZX550.3
It is a 3-Channel Amplifier with Class D 3rd Channel for Subwoofer(s)
w/Remote Bass Control (controls subwoofer channel only)

2008_07_06_kicker_002_zx550_3.jpg


The Speaker are simple and should keep the Interior very Clean.
6-1/2" RS Series 2-Way Component System
1" Teteron elliptical dome tweeter with neodymium magnet

2008_07_06_kicker_004_rs65_2.jpg


Of Course you need to have a little bass and Kicker has the perfect subwoofer for the small cab.
10" Shallow-Mount Subwoofer

2008_07_06_kicker_005.jpg


Mounting Depth is only 4-3/16"
Yep, that's shallow - perfect for such a small cab.
